编程教育新认知
在人工智能时代背景下,编程教育已突破传统认知边界。不同于职业程序员培养,少儿编程本质上是建立人机对话的桥梁,通过可视化编程工具将抽象逻辑具象化。以Scratch为例,儿童可通过积木式指令组合实现动画创作、游戏设计等实践项目,这种基于项目制的学习方式能有效提升逻辑推理能力与问题解决能力。
| 学习阶段 | 适用年龄 | 核心工具 | 能力培养重点 |
|---|---|---|---|
| 启蒙阶段 | 5-7岁 | ScratchJr | 指令逻辑理解 |
| 基础阶段 | 8-10岁 | Scratch 3.0 | 算法思维建立 |
| 进阶阶段 | 11-13岁 | Python | 代码实现能力 |
教学实施路径
优质编程课程设计遵循认知发展规律,厦门地区培训机构普遍采用三级进阶体系。初级阶段通过动画角色控制理解坐标概念,中级阶段引入条件判断实现游戏关卡设计,高级阶段结合硬件编程完成物联网项目开发。这种阶梯式课程结构确保学习者能稳步提升计算思维水平。
课程实施注重跨学科融合,编程项目常结合数学几何知识进行图形绘制,利用物理原理模拟运动轨迹。某编程夏令营的"智能交通系统"项目,要求学员综合运用变量控制、传感器原理和逻辑运算,完成红绿灯时长优化算法设计。
课程特色解析
厦门编程教育机构普遍采用双师教学模式,线上直播配合线下实践的工作坊形式。课程常包含48-96课时,分为基础模块、拓展模块和竞赛模块。部分机构引入美国CSTA标准,将课程目标细化为计算思维、协作创新、数字公民三大维度。
教学成果评估采用作品集展示方式,学员需定期完成主题项目并参与代码评审会。某学员的"疫情数据可视化"项目,通过Python爬虫获取实时数据,运用Matplotlib库生成动态图表,该项目在市级科技创新大赛中获得优胜奖。
家长决策指南
选择编程培训机构需重点考察课程体系完整性,优质课程应包含明确的能力发展图谱。建议实地体验试听课,观察教师是否采用引导式教学法。课程费用通常按学期收取,厦门地区市场价格区间为每课时80-150元,包含教材费与平台使用费。
学习效果评估应关注过程性成长,定期查看学员的项目复杂度提升情况。避免过度追求考级考证,重点关注逻辑思维、问题拆解、调试纠错等核心能力的实质性进步。




